The trainee will rotate across Sales, Marketing, Automotive Logistics, and Aftersales, amongst other functional areas, gaining hands-on experience with multiple mobility brands including Toyota, Suzuki, Yamaha, and Commercial Trucks/Equipment. The program provides exposure to commercial operations, customer engagement, brand management, digital marketing, events execution, and supply-chain coordination. The key objective is to build a strong foundation for a long-term career in sales and marketing while grooming high performers for potential permanent roles, subject to available vacancies. Requirements Principal Accountabilities: During the programme, the Graduate Trainee will be assigned responsibilities across various functional areas, gaining exposure to a broad range of commercial and operational activities. These may include, but are not limited to, the following: 1. Sales - Learn and apply sales techniques, including value selling, negotiation, closing, and objection handling.
- Learn brand positioning and product knowledge across all CFAO Mobility brands.
- Participate in prospecting, lead qualification, and customer engagement across B2B, B2C, NGO/UN, and Government segments.
- Support Sales Consultants in preparing quotations, tenders, and RFQ submissions within agreed SLAs.
- Assist with showroom operations, demo/test drive coordination, and CRM data accuracy.
2. Marketing - Participate in campaign planning, execution, and postâcampaign reporting.
- Support events and experiential marketing activities, including customer activations, product launches, and brand showcases.
- Assist with the development of marketing content, social media coordination, and campaign performance tracking.
- Conduct market and competitor analysis to support data-driven marketing decisions.
3. After-sales - Learn the fundamentals of after-sales operations, including service bookings, customer follow-ups, and workshop coordination.
- Observe key workshop processes to understand how technical service, parts availability, and product knowledge contribute to brand loyalty.
- Collaborate with technical teams to understand OEM standards and how after-sales supports overall customer retention.
4. Automotive Logistics - Gain understanding of key automotive supply-chain processes, including:
- Vehicle clearance and registration
- Pre-delivery inspections aligned to OEM standards
- Order-to-delivery coordination with sales and after-sales teams
5. Learning & Professional Development - Participate fully in all structured learning programmes, including online courses, inâperson workshops, and rotational assessments.
- Apply learning to real business scenarios and demonstrate continuous personal and professional growth.
- Contribute to team assignments, presentations, and improvement projects across departments.
Key Challenges: - Balancing steep learning demands while adapting quickly to fast-paced automotive operations.
- Maintaining a high level of professionalism when dealing with diverse customer profiles.
- Applying both analytical and creative thinking to support marketing and sales initiatives.
- Navigating multiple rotations while consistently meeting learning objectives and deliverables.
Job Knowledge, Skills & Experiences: Minimum qualifications - Bachelorâs Degree in Business, Economics, Engineering, Communications, or any related field.
- Recent graduate (within 0â2 years) with strong academic standing.
- Demonstrated interest in sales, marketing, and the mobility/automotive industry.
Skills & Competencies - Good presentation and communication skills (verbal & written).
- Strong analytical skills and ability to interpret data.
- Ability to work with diverse teams in a multicultural environment.
Key personal attributes: - Young, passionate, and highly driven individual with a desire to excel in sales and marketing.
- Fast learner with strong problemâsolving skills in dynamic environments.
- Excellent interpersonal skills with the ability to build relationships with customers and internal teams.
- High level of integrity, professionalism, and commitment to continuous learning.
- Adaptability and willingness to take on new assignments across departments.
Value Proposition â Whatâs in It for the Successful Candidate? - Personal Development: Access to structured professional and personal growth programmes.
- Exciting Challenges: Exposure to real business challenges from day one.
- Early Responsibilities: Opportunity to contribute to live projects and operations early in your career.
- Networking: Work with diverse customers across Government, B2B, and B2C segments.
- Earning Potential: Monthly retainer plus eligibility for sales commissions upon closing sales.
- Career Pathway: As a key talent pipeline initiative, the programme positions top performers for potential placement into suitable roles following completion, contingent on business needs and vacancy availability.
